Digital and Wireless Communications
Digital transmission over wireless and wired networks forms the bulk of research activities in the area of digital and optical communications. In these areas, a variety of research problems leading to more efficient and reliable communications systems are under investigation. The research topics in wireless networks include the study of propagation mechanisms over a wide frequency range, channel characterization and modeling, modulation, detection and estimation, indoor wireless network architectures, mobile cellular systems, equalization and diversity, and packet radio systems.
